About Dr. Prajesh Bhuta
Dr. Prajesh Bhuta is an internationally trained doctor with over 29 years of experience. He served as Clinical Lead in laparoscopic day-care colorectal units at St. Helens & Knowsley Hospital, UK, and returned to India in 2009. As Colorectal Surgery lead at Jaslok Hospital, Dr. Prajesh Bhuta offers advanced laparoscopic and robotic procedures, treating bowel cancer, inflammatory bowel disease, and pelvic floor disorders.

Education
- MBBS – KEM Hospital & G.S. Medical College, Mumbai, 1995
- MS (General Surgery) – LTMMC, Mumbai, 1998
- FRCS (General Surgery) – Royal College of Surgeons, Edinburgh, UK, 1999
- MD/Coloproctology – Royal College of Surgeons, Edinburgh, UK, 2007
- CCT (Colorectal Surgery), UK
Training & Certificates
- Robotic Colorectal Surgery – Strasbourg, France
- Minimally Invasive Visceral & Advanced Colorectal Surgery – Hamburg, Germany
- Stapled Haemorrhoidectomy & Pelvic Floor – Liverpool, UK
- Laparoscopic Hernia Surgery – Edinburgh, Scotland
- STARR Procedure – Dundee, UK
Associations/Membership
- Fellow, Royal College of Surgeons, Edinburgh
- Association of Colon & Rectum Surgeons of India (Vice President)
- Pelvic Floor Society (Secretary)
- Course Convener – INNMAST Laparoscopic Colorectal Course
